The Villages
Location: Sumter County, Florida; Marion County, Florida
Size: 51,200 acres
Homes: 71,000
Slogan: “Free Golf for Life”
Description: A sprawling 55-plus community infamous for its active residents, living a freewheeling lifestyle in what is — according to popular legend — the “STD capital of America.”
Lake Weir Living
Location: Ocklawaha, Florida
Size: 400 acres
Homes: 300
Slogan: “Live Where You Ride”
Description: Lake Weir Living is a retirement community dedicated to “toy” lovers: elderly people who can’t quite give up their motorcycles, RVs, boats, cars, and other vehicles.
Latitude Margaritaville
Location: Daytona Beach, Florida; Watersound, Florida; Hilton Head, North Carolina
Size: 8,820+ acres
Homes: 10,400
Slogan: “Growing Older but Not Up”
Description: Named for the eponymous Jimmy Buffett song, this Jimmy-Buffett-themed chain of three communities is home to residents who share two interests: golf and liquor.
